From Data to Decisions: Making Predictions with AI

This course is part of From Data To Decision With AI.

This course provides an applied introduction to bivariate and multiple regression with a focus on using generative AI as an analytical partner. Students will learn how to effectively structure research questions, execute regression models with AI assistance, and interpret key statistical outputs including coefficients and R-squared values. The curriculum emphasizes practical applications, teaching students to leverage AI tools for streamlining complex analyses and enhancing prediction accuracy. Through hands-on assignments, learners will develop skills in predicting outcomes from data and clearly communicating insights derived from regression models. The course is particularly valuable for professionals seeking to make data-driven decisions in real-world contexts. Those with limited data analysis experience are advised to first complete the prerequisite courses in the specialization for better preparation.

Department Chair, Department of Leadership, Policy, and Organizations

Will Doyle is a professor of public policy and higher education in the department of Leadership, Policy and Organizations at Peabody College of Vanderbilt University. Doyle serves as Editor-in-Chief of Research in Higher Education. His research includes evaluating the impact of higher education policy, the antecedents and outcomes of higher education policy at the state level and the study of political behavior as it affects higher education. Prior to joining the faculty at Vanderbilt, he was Senior Policy Analyst at the National Center for Public Policy and Higher Education. Doyle received a Master’s degree in Political Science and a PhD in Higher Education Administration from Stanford University in 2004. Doyle's recent work has explored the link between geographic opportunity for higher education and its impact on both earnings and civic outcomes. His recent policy-related work has examined the status of college affordability in every sector of higher education in all 50 states.
